Здравствуйте!
Тема такая - по конвейеру идут объекты, их надо посчитать, я обучил каскадный классификатор (процентов 90 он определяет - иногда проскакивают кадры где не определяется , но в целом каждый объект определен), вытащил координаты найденных объектов, пытаюсь сделать счетчик по расстоянию до условной линии. Но натыкаюсь на то, что он считает объекты по количеству кадров т.е был объект 5 сек в кадрах со скоростью 5к\сек получили 25 объектов. Еще сложнее если вдруг появляется два объекта. Попытался сделать с ROI - вырезал небольшой участок и на нем уже получил очень близкие к достоверным результаты. Но понимаю что это неправильно. Помогите как отслеживать именно найденный объект (видел ролики где над объектом пририсовывалась цифра и не менялась по всему треку слежения) и сравнивать расстояние до линии. Возможно ли реализовать чтоб в центре объекта ставилась точка и слежение происходило за ней?, Я пробовал, но к 10 кадру у меня 8-10 таких точек в центре объекта. и не смог реализовать удаление не всех точек на экране а тех которые вышли из заданной области у меня через пару минут в верхней области экрана пару сотен таких точек.
Извините за "многобукаф".